A bottleneck is an operation that has the lowest effective capacity of any operation in the process. True/False

Respuesta :

jitushashi100 jitushashi100
  • 26-04-2020

Answer:

True

Explanation:

Yes, it is very true that a bottleneck is an operation that carries less effective capacity of any operation in the method. If its output is less than market demand then the process with the least capacity is also known as bottleneck.
